SCOTLAND WATER SCARCITY LEVELS 11 SEPT 2025Scotland's east coast is facing record pressure on its rivers, with 17 areas now at Significant Scarcity - the highest number since the current version of the National Water Scarcity Plan was introduced.

EA Outstrays Managed Realignment SchemeThe Environment Agency and a wide range of partners have completed the Outstrays Managed Realignment Scheme, creating 250ha of intertidal habitat by embankment realignment at a total cost of £56.3 million.
